LaBike (Lab On Bike)
LaBike(Lab on bike) is a unique concept that combines mobility and healthcare. It is a laboratory on a motorbike equipped with necessary diagnostic equipment, such as a portable biochemistry lab, digital microscope, urine analyzer, BMI monitor, bio-waste management facilities, onboard power backup, and a GPS tracker. Over 100 different types of tests can be performed with LaBike. Accuster Technologies’ innovative approach aims to bring diagnostics closer to people, especially in remote and underserved areas.
Its portability and comprehensive diagnostic capabilities make it suitable for last-mile care, providing services to people’s doorsteps, as well as to subcenters, primary health centers (PHCs), health and wellness centers (HWCs), and community health centers (CHCs).
Role Overview
Labike is seeking an experienced, hands-on Program Director – Medical Camps (Field Operations) to lead the end-to-end planning, mapping, execution, and management of medical camps. This is a field-intensive leadership role requiring strong execution capability, proactive problem-solving, and complete ownership of on-ground delivery.
The role combines strategic planning with direct field execution, ensuring medical camps are delivered efficiently, safely, within budget, and with measurable impact.
